GGuest UserOn that cold and dark winter evebing, we were gracefully helped by phone by the reception lady in order to reach the hotel located within the pedestrian corner of the city. A beautiful Maison de Maître serves as the Edgar hôtel. Check-in was swift and pleasant, and we had access to an elevator for our humougous suitcases. We entered a beautifully-decorated and warm bedroom, and were nicely advised by our receptionist on which restaurant would be open for dinner (winter Sunday night). Had a resting sleep and a tasty breakfast. Only good things to say, basically.
I want to emphasize here that we had a wheel chair accessible bedroom on the 1st floor (the hotel has 3), which I found interesting. The bathroom was all planned for wheel chair access. In case anyone here needs this type of facility, you can book Edgar hotel!
